Engaging Students in STEM Exploration: Hands-on Learning
In today's rapidly evolving world, nurturing a passion for science, technology, engineering, and mathematics (STEM) is paramount. Hands-on learning provides an unparalleled opportunity to spark student interest in these crucial fields. By permitting students to experiment concepts through direct participation, educators can transform the learning experience.
- Moreover, hands-on activities enhance critical thinking, problem-solving, and collaboration skills – vital competencies for success in the 21st century.
- For instance, building a simple circuit can demonstrate fundamental electrical or mechanical principles in a way that traditional lectures cannot achieve.
Therefore, hands-on learning equips students to become active learners in the STEM world, motivating them to pursue careers that shape our future.
